Frequently Asked Questions

What triggers issues with drywall?

Drywall damage can occur due to various reasons, including water leaks, physical damage, structural settling, improper installation, or natural wear and tear over time.

What are the signs that the drywall needs repairing?

Look for signs such as cracks, holes, staining from water, or bulging areas on your drywall. If you notice these issues, it's time to consider drywall repair.

Is it recommended to fix drywall issues on my own, or is it more suitable to hire a professional?

It depends on the extent of the damage and your DIY skills. Small holes and minor cracks can often be repaired by homeowners. However, for significant damage or if you're unsure, hiring a professional like us is recommended.

How can I repair larger holes in the wall?

For larger holes, you may need to patch the area with a drywall patch or mesh tape, apply joint compound, sand, and then apply a new coat of paint.

What tools and materials are needed for a do-it-yourself drywall repair?

Basic tools include a spatula, joint compound, sanding paper, saw for drywall, mesh tape, and painting supplies. Depending on the repair type, you might need additional items.

How long does the repair of drywall typically take?

The time for drywall repair varies based on the extent of the damage. Minor repairs can often be finished in a few hours, while larger repairs may take a day or more.

Can water-damaged drywall be fixed, or is it necessary to replaced?

Minor water damage can often be repaired, but extensive damage might necessitate replacing of the affected drywall.

Jerome is a city in and county seat of Jerome County, Idaho, United States. The population was 10,890 at the 2010 census, up from 7,780 in 2000. The city is the county seat of Jerome County, and is part of the Twin Falls Micropolitan Statistical Area. It is the second largest city in Idaho's Magic Valley region, second only to Twin Falls which is located 10 miles (16 km) southeast. Jerome's economy is largely agrarian, with dairy farming being one of the main revenue sources for the local economy.
